For those that don’t know, and that is nearly everyone, Stockwell Day was the leader of the Canadian Alliance (the successor to the Reform Party) in the early 2000s.
Decades ago, when the old Progressive Conservative Party was pretty useless on issues of individual rights, the Reform Party under Preston Manning did very well and came within a seat or so of becoming the Official Opposition to the Liberal government.
In 1995 there was a by-election in Ottawa—Vanier (and further by-elections in 1996) that could have helped Reform overtake the Bloc Québécois for Official Opposition status. I remember this clearly because it was the only time in my life I went door-knocking for a political party.
The goal was to get the BQ out of Official Opposition.  In 2000 the Reform Party became the Canadian Alliance. Stockwell Day won the leadership contest that year and, after the November 2000 election, became Leader of the Official Opposition.
